Eye diseases such as cataracts, glaucoma, and severe myopia can drastically impair vision. In many cases, surgery is the only solution to prevent complete blindness. Unfortunately, these procedures can be costly, and not everyone can cover the expenses. When insurance or government aid is insufficient, patients and their families must turn to alternative ways to raise funds.

Craft an engaging personal account
Telling the story of the patient’s challenges and dreams inspires generosity. Genuine emotion and sincerity matter.
Utilize digital fundraising portals
Websites like GoFundMe?, JustGiving?, or dedicated charity sites (e.g., helpmyeyes.com) allow easy donation collection and sharing.
Promote through social channels
Using social media helps reach a wider audience. Ask supporters to share posts with campaign hashtags.
Approach local groups and associations
Faith communities, educational centers, and social clubs may help raise funds.
Organize fundraising events
Charity runs, auctions, bake sales, or concerts can raise funds and awareness simultaneously.
Maintain openness and regular communication
Keep supporters updated on campaign status and patient condition. This builds trust and encourages continued support.
